Balance of Payments
A comprehensive record of all economic transactions between residents of a country and the rest of the world during a specific period.
Balance-of-Economic Transactions
A record of all economic transactions between residents of a country and the rest of the world during a particular period, including trade, investments, and financial transfers.
Bretton Woods Agreement
The Bretton Woods Agreement was established in 1944 to set up a new international monetary system, creating exchange rate stability and promoting international economic cooperation.
Exchange Rates
The value of one currency expressed in terms of another currency, which determines how much foreign currency can be exchanged for a unit of domestic currency.
